  1. Distributed control reconfiguration algorithms for 2-dimensional mesh architectures

    Reconfiguration algorithms for 2-dimensional-mesh architectures are presented based upon different interconnect schemes and various numbers of spare cells, arranged in spare rows and/or spare columns. Advantages of these algorithms over existing algorithms is discussed.

  2. A distributed control reconfiguration algorithm for 2-dimensional mesh architectures which tolerates single faults per row

    A reconfiguration is developed for 2-dimensional mesh architectures and applied to a fault T tolerant cellular architecture.
